Bitcoin made its debut in 2009, thanks to an anonymous figure known as Satoshi Nakamoto, marking the start of the cryptocurrency revolution. Significant milestones include the first-ever transaction using Bitcoin in 2010 and major forks like Bitcoin Cash in 2017, which diverged from the original blockchain.

Altcoins, short for "alternative coins," encompass any cryptocurrency that isn't Bitcoin. They come in several varieties, each serving different purposes:

  • Utility Tokens: Coins designed to grant access to specific services (e.g., Ethereum).
  • Security Tokens: Tokens that represent ownership in an asset and are often regulated.
  • Stablecoins: Cryptocurrencies pegged to stable assets like the US dollar (e.g., USDT).

2.2 Spotlight on Leading Altcoins

  • Ethereum (ETH): Renowned for its smart contract capabilities, Ethereum holds the title of the second-largest cryptocurrency by market cap.
  • Solana (SOL): Famed for its lightning-fast transactions and minimal fees, Solana has become a favorite among DApp developers.
  • Cardano (ADA): Known for its focus on sustainability and scalability, Cardano is carving out its niche in the altcoin arena.
